Andreas Mikkelsen continues to lead after the end of day 2

Andreas Mikkelsen continues to lead after the end of day 2.
Bruno Magalhaes: SS 4: “It was difficult, very slippery. Sometimes you have grip, other times it is not much. I have to improve the traction because the car is always oversteering.”
In stage 5 the second in the overall standing Juho Hanninen spin with a high speed. He lost more than 10 seconds in a slippery downhill section.
Bruno Magalhães reported a “big, big moment” near the stage 5 start as lost precious seconds challenging the third place.
Stage 6 was the last stage for Bruno Magalhães who is out of the home rally. The seven kilometres stage for the Portugal star was the last for the rally as he went off the road and stopped on the roof. The both crew out of the rally without injury.
The leader Andreas Mikkelsen continues to grown his overall advantage to Juho Hanninen.
Stage 8 was cancelled due too bad road (mud and water) caused by weather.
Results after SS 9 (Day 2):
1. A. Mikkelsen 1:05:34.0
2. J. Hanninen +16.2
3. B. Bouffier +1:17.9
4. H. Gassner +3:26.3
5. S. Wiegand +3:36.2
